Insight Compass
education and learning /

What is encoding in image compression?

What is encoding in image compression?

Image compression coding is to store the image into bit-stream as compact as possible and to display the decoded image in the monitor as exact as possible. When the encoder receives the original image file, the image file will be converted into a series of binary data, which is called the bit-stream.

What is coding in digital image processing?

An effective image coding technique is to decompose the image signal into a set of components that can be more efficiently quantized than the original signal. This class of coding schemes includes transform coding and subband coding, which are widely used in image compression.

How does Huffman coding work in image compression?

Huffman coding is a lossless data compression technique. Huffman coding is based on the frequency of occurrence of a data item i.e. pixel in images. The technique is to use a lower number of bits to encode the data in to binary codes that occurs more frequently. It is used in JPEG files.

What is coding redundancy in image processing?

Coding Redundancy: If the gray levels of an image are coded in a way that uses more code symbols than absolutely necessary to represent each gray level then the resulting image is said to contain coding redundancy.

Is an image compression standard and coding system?

Continuous tone still image compression standards For photograph quality images (both grayscale and color), different standards have been proposed, mostly based on lossy compression techniques. The most popular standard in this category, by far, is the JPEG standard [7, 8], a lossy, DCT-based coding algorithm.

What are the coding system in JPEG?

The JPEG standard defined four compression modes: Hierarchical, Progressive, Sequential and lossless. Figure 0 shows the relationship of major JPEG compression modes and encoding processes. Sequential: Sequential-mode images are encoded from top to bottom.

What is pixel in image processing?

A: In digital imaging, a pixel(or picture element) is the smallest item of information in an image. Pixels are arranged in a 2-dimensional grid, represented using squares. Each pixel is a sample of an original image, where more samples typically provide more-accurate representations of the original.

What is entropy coding and how can it be used to compress data?

In information theory an entropy coding (or entropy encoding) is a lossless data compression scheme that is independent of the specific characteristics of the medium. One of the main types of entropy coding creates and assigns a unique prefix-free code to each unique symbol that occurs in the input.

How are modeling and coding related?

Developers generally differentiate between modeling and coding. Models are used for designing systems, understanding them better, specifying required functionality, and creating documentation. Code is then written to implement the designs. Debugging, testing, and maintenance are done on the code level too.

How does LZW compression work?

LZW compression works by reading a sequence of symbols, grouping the symbols into strings, and converting the strings into codes. Decoding is achieved by taking each code from the compressed file and translating it through the code table to find what character or characters it represents.

Why Huffman coding is lossless compression?

Huffman coding is a lossless data compression algorithm. The idea is to assign variable-length codes to input characters, lengths of the assigned codes are based on the frequencies of corresponding characters. This coding leads to ambiguity because code assigned to c is the prefix of codes assigned to a and b.